presteerden
Presteerden is the past tense form of the Dutch verb presteren, used with plural subjects to indicate that they performed, achieved, or delivered something in the past.
Grammatical notes: The past tense with singular subjects is presteerde; the plural past tense is presteerden.

Examples: De teams presteerden goed tijdens de finale. De werknemers presteerden beter dan verwacht.
